I have a 2001 ZX3 with the 2 litre zetec engine. It has 34,000 miles on it. Today on the way home from school, i got stuck in bumper to bumber traffic. As i was sitting stopped for like hours at a time, i would notice that the temperature gauge would slowly rise, and i would have to shut the car off and let it cool. After playing around with it, i realized that the cooling fan was never coming on to cool the car at idle. If the AC is on, then the fan runs and the car cools down. however, if the car is idling, and starts to overheat, if i revv the engine a couple times (to about 2k rpms, then 3k) the headlights would flicker quickly and then what do you know, the fan clicks on, cools the car, then shuts off. So the fan works when the motor is not idling, and when the AC is on. I really need to fix this cause my dads gonna get mad if he thinks something is broken. Any help is appreciated
